Monster Train 2has a variety of different ways to upgrade your units, from permanently stacking buffs toMerchants Of Steel,which are rooms located between battles. These come stocked with lots of unique upgrades, like Largestone, Immortalstone, or Mossystone. You’ll need to spend gold to upgrade your units, and as a default, cardsonly have two upgrade slots- though this can be upgraded with an artifact.

How To Upgrade Your Units

Units in Monster Hunter 2 are primarily upgraded viaMerchants Of Steel. These are upgrade rooms located between each battle on your run.

You’ll have a choice offourupgrades per shop, although you can rerollonceto take a look at some other options. The four options will range fromcheaptoexpensive,with the more impactful upgrades usually costing upwards of 100 gold.

However, you may also get upgrades from theCelestial Alcove.This is a rare upgrade room that has any number of possible events, including unit upgrade options - likeTitanskin.

The room after the first battle willalwayshave both a Merchant of Steel and a Merchant of Magic to choose from.
